19 - Spammers just don’t understand
Below is a spam (high priority no less!) I just got (I did remove the headers to save the poor idiot some grief.)
I almost shot juice through my nose when I got to the part I’ve hilighted in bold…

I come to the point of sending this letter for the reasons of introducing the business which I belong at the moment, and also, I am interested to know the business venture that you are currently working. Perhaps you were surprised on how did I obtain your email address.
Actually, I obtain this e-add once I go to see some of the web sites in the net. And it happened, that this e-mail address is enclosed on the portion of the page, which certainly triggered my intimacy to send letter of invitation.
The first thing that necessitates me before sending you this letter, is to well thought-out the consequences. I might wasting your precious time and privacy. But because of my desire to spread the word of my business, I took all the risk to pursue sending.
Maybe I violated the Spam Law because you are not requesting any information from me in regards to business. That is why I didn’t include any of them to minimize my violation.
To lessen my violation in Spam Law, I would like to ask your permission to send you the information about my business. You can reply to this letter with the subject MORE INFO and also your first name on the body of it. Because with out any of those permissions is already my violation, right?
I am gladly anticipating for your nice reply and at the same time we can exchange businesses for evaluation as soon as possible.
God Bless us all.
First, I admit I broke the law, but I don’t care.
Second, to make sure I don’t get caught I won’t tell you who I am.
Third, I won’t even tell you what the heck I’m selling…
Fourth, even if you were intriqued enough to care, you can’t find me (catch me if you can…)
And these morons think that they’ll get money from people??? The really sad part is that they’re probably right…
